Madison Malibu Realtor: Your Key to Coastal Paradise

Madison Malibu realtor professionals guide buyers and sellers through one of California’s most competitive coastal markets. This overview highlights how expert local representation impacts transaction outcomes in this high-value neighborhood.

Real estate dynamics in Madison Malibu blend oceanfront appeal, strict zoning, and premium pricing. Understanding agent specialization, marketing approaches, and negotiation tactics helps clients move decisively in this luxury segment.

Working With a Madison Malibu Realtor

A Madison Malibu realtor brings hyperlocal knowledge of zoning rules, historic guidelines, and coastal development restrictions. They handle showings, contract negotiations, and inspection contingencies while safeguarding privacy and reputation in a discreet enclave.

Agent Vetting Checklist

When choosing representation, verify recent closed sales in Madison Malibu, review client testimonials, confirm marketing plans including professional photography, and clarify commission structures and team coverage during peak seasons.

FAQ

Reader questions

How does coastal regulation affect Madison Malibu listings? Coastal setback rules, FEMA flood zones, and local ordinances can limit renovations and rebuild options. Your Madison Malibu realtor will disclose restrictions early and recommend architects familiar with compliance to prevent costly surprises. What makes a Madison Malibu realtor different from a general agent?

Local specialists know neighborhood nuances, such as school attendance boundaries, security protocols, and microclimate impacts on property upkeep. They also access off-market opportunities and established relationships with inspectors and contractors familiar with coastal construction.

What is a reasonable offer in a multiple-offer Madison Malibu situation?

In competitive settings, clean contracts with flexible inspections, solid financing proof, and personalized context about buyer intent increase appeal. Your Madison Malibu realtor crafts offers that balance price respect with terms that reassure sellers in this premium segment.

How should I prepare my Madison Malibu home for showings?

Declutter, maximize ocean views, service key systems, and refresh high-visibility areas. A Madison Malibu realtor can coordinate staging, schedule professional photography, and suggest curb improvements that align with neighborhood expectations without overspending.
